Resultados de la búsqueda a petición "ruby"

5 la respuesta

¿Cómo obtener la extensión de archivo de una url?

Nuevo en Ruby, ¿cómo obtendría la extensión de archivo de una URL como: http://www.example.com/asdf123.gifAdemás, ¿cómo formatearía esta cadena? En C # haría: string.format("http://www.example.com/{0}.{1}", filename, extension);

4 la respuesta

Estrategias para anular database.yml?

En mi entorno, los servidores de implementación tienen gran parte de la información de conexión que se encuentra en la base de datos.yml. Es decir, saben si son servidores de desarrollo, prueba o producción, y conocen su respectiva información de ...

1 la respuesta

responder al hilo google-api-ruby-client

Así es como se ve mi código (más o menos) para crear un mensaje usando google-api-ruby-client: service ||= Google::Apis::GmailV1::GmailService.new message = RMail::Message.new message.header['To'] = params[:gmail][:to] message.header['From'] ...

3 la respuesta

¿Por qué no decodeURI (“a + b”) == “a b”?

Estoy tratando de codificar URL en Ruby y decodificarlas con Javascript. Sin embargo, el carácter positivo me está dando un comportamiento extraño. En rubí: [Dev]> CGI.escape "a b" => "a+b" [Dev]> CGI.unescape "a+b" => "a b"Hasta aquí todo ...

3 la respuesta

Ruby Timeout :: timeout no dispara Exception y no devuelve lo documentado

Tengo esta pieza de código: begin complete_results = Timeout.timeout(4) do results = platform.search(artist, album_name) end rescue Timeout::Error puts 'Print me something please' endLuego lanzo el método que contiene este código, y bueno, aquí ...

4 la respuesta

Facturación recurrente con Rails y ActiveMerchant: ¿Mejores prácticas, trampas, trampas?

Nos estamos preparando para el lanzamiento de una gran aplicación web que ha estado en desarrollo durante el año pasado. Estamos a punto de comenzar el proceso de integración de ActiveMerchant para manejar tarifas de suscripción recurrentes para ...

3 la respuesta

Consulta de espacio de nombres de Nokogiri / Xpath

Estoy tratando de sacar eldc:title elemento utilizando un xpath. Puedo extraer los metadatos usando el siguiente código. doc = <<END <?xml version="1.0" encoding="UTF-8"?> <package xmlns="http://www.idpf.org/2007/opf" version="2.0"> <metadata ...

3 la respuesta

¿Cómo convertir el código de caracteres a lo que quiero?

Haciendo esto: s = "hello" s[0]da salida al valor del código de caracteres104. ¿Qué necesito hacer para convertir el104 tal que salga 'h'? Estoy usando ruby 1.8.7.

12 la respuesta

Procesamiento paralelo desde una cola de comandos en Linux (bash, python, ruby ... lo que sea)

Tengo una lista / cola de 200 comandos que necesito ejecutar en un shell en un servidor Linux. Solo quiero tener un máximo de 10 procesos en ejecución (desde la cola) a la vez. Algunos procesos tardarán unos segundos en completarse, otros ...

3 la respuesta

¿Por qué el método de inyección Ruby no puede resumir longitudes de cadena sin valor inicial?

¿Por qué el siguiente código emite un error? ['hello','stack','overflow'].inject{|memo,s|memo+s.length} TypeError: can't convert Fixnum into String from (irb):2:in `+' from (irb):2:in `block in irb_binding' from (irb):2:in `each' from (irb):2:in ...